The Senior Director, Data Management will design and implement data models, data architectures, data warehouses, data marts, reporting solutions and ETLs for the Business Intelligence team in order to facilitate a high level of data and information utilization within the organization. This role will also be responsible for creating, documenting and implementing data governance policies and procedures. Working with the Sr. Director, incumbent will help develop and implement enterprise wide business intelligence strategy, governance, and data architecture that meets and exceeds current and future organizational needs. Incumbent will work closely with organizational stakeholders to help define and implement solutions that result in a standardized and robustdata and information storage and reporting environment.

- Manage the development of the organization’s data management architecture and strategy
- Manage the ongoing development and operations of a business intelligence architecture that enables fact-based decision making, ad-hoc analysis, and insight generation in alignment with organizational objectives
- Work with Project Managers and directly with organizational stakeholders to define project scope and plans to achieve data and information management objectives
- Directly manage a team of BI/DW development professionals by organizing, prioritizing and scheduling work assignments
- Identify areas to improve information efficiency and effectiveness at all levels from collection to analysis
- Create standards and governance for data and information collection, storage, and reporting; Provide recommendations and tools to facilitate the necessary business process changes to support standards and policies
- Develop and maintain policies, best practices, procedures and guidelines necessary to effectively administer a data warehouse and business intelligence solution
- Work directly with various vendor partners leveraging external expertise and solutions while maintaining focus on organizational data strategy goals and objectives
- Improve and streamline processes of data flows and data quality to improve accuracy, viability, and value
- Collaborate with departments and end users to identify needs and opportunities for improved data management and delivery; Communicate complex concepts and solutions to achieve stakeholder consensus regarding proposed technical solutions and business process changes
- Evaluate new technology and techniques to implement, maintain and improve the BI and database environment

- A bachelor’s degree is required
- Must possess a minimum of 7 years of experience working with complex database systems, business intelligence tools, and related systems including data warehouses, data acquisition processes, and data structures to support reporting and analysis.
- Must have 2 - 4 years managerial experience
- Must possess a strong analytical acumen and a passionate curiosity for data
- Core knowledge of Microsoft BI technologies, including PowerBI, SharePoint, SQL Server, SSRS, SSIS, SSAS is required
- Experience with Azure SQL as a Service, SQL Data Warehouse and Data Factor is preferred
- Strong collaboration and communication skills as well as a successful track record of working with executives and cross-functional teams is required
- Must possess excellent organizational skills, proactive, with the ability to manage multiple responsibilities. Must be comfortable working in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and committed to meeting deadlines and creating and improving processes
- Must be able to function as an effective team leader
- Must possess demonstrated skills in analyzing enterprise data warehouse and business intelligence systems, including the integration of data from various sources
- Demonstrated knowledge of BI analytical reporting tools including data discovery solutions or similar dashboard and scorecard reporting of real-time data
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ills are required
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ills are required
- Must possess the ability to work with minimal supervision
